    Data Analyst - Fleming Fund Grant

    ADVERT REF, AD/8/150/24, 1 POST
    The Position

    The position is domiciled in the Department of Clinical Medicine and Therapeutics in the Faculty of Health Sciences, under the Fleming Fund Kenya Grant. This is a project that will be conducted in several hospitals in Kenya to strengthen surveillance of antimicrobial resistance and antimicrobial use.

    Location

    The position will be based at the Department of Clinical Medicine and Therapeutics and will report to the Principal Investigator.

    Duties and Responsibilities

    • Update, write, validate and run statistical programs for monitoring and statistics (e.g. creation of datasets, tables, figures and listings).
    • Conduct data analysis and generate surveillance reports.
    • Assist with data cleaning and data management.
    • Prepare data documentation including data dictionaries, codebooks and data use manuals.
    • Summarize data and prepare routine and ad hoc reports and presentations to meet reporting requirements and requests for donors and stakeholders (e.g. PowerPoint, Dashboards).
    • Provide statistical programming expertise to project teams by preparing analytic data files, writing code for macros and utilizing macro libraries.
    • Develops and updates specifications for automated monitoring reports to be generated by study or project databases.
    • Perform other related duties as assigned.

    Job Specifications

    • Master’s degree in any of the following fields: Biostatistics, Applied Statistics, Data Science or equivalent combination of education and experience preferred.
    • Demonstrated experience in data analysis (preferably using R and/or STATA) and statistical analysis with a high level of organization, autonomy, technical skill and team orientation
    • 3-5 years of related experience designing, managing and working directly with databases from research studies
    • Demonstrated writing skills: reports, presentations and/or protocols
    • Demonstrated experience executing statistical programs for the creation of tables, figures, listings and analysis databases
    • Demonstrated expertise in project- specific dataset/database structures and related data cleaning and coding methods
